How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Gateway Park?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Gateway Park Studio Apartments | $1,448 | $919 | $1,839 |
Gateway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,393 | $825 | $2,000 |
Gateway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,337 | $725 | $3,400 |
Gateway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,410 | $599 | $3,395 |
Gateway Park 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,046 | $669 | $2,200 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Gateway Park
How much are Studio apartments in Gateway Park?
There are currently 24 Studio Apartments in Gateway Park with rent ranges from $919 to $1,839 with an average price of $1,448.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Gateway Park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Gateway Park ranges from $825 to $2,000 with an average monthly rent of $1,393.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Gateway Park c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Gateway Park range from $725 to $3,400.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,337.
How expensive are Gateway Park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 43 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Gateway Park on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$599 to $3,395 - averaging $1,410 for the location.
